Description of the WLED Controller Board V43:

With this product, for example, a string of lights or lighting system controlled via WLAN can be set up. It is based on an ESP32 microcontroller. To set up a chain of lights or lighting system, a power supply unit and one or more LED strips are required in addition to this product. The following LED types are supported: WS2812B, WS2813, WS2815, SK6812(RGBW, RGBNW, RGBWW), APA102, WS2801, WS2811, LPD8806, WS2814 RGBW, COB-RGB WS28xx, WS2805 SPI RGBCCT (as of WLED 0.15.x), APA106 (as of WLED 0.15.x). 5V, 12V and 24V LED strips are supported.
The controller essentially consists of an ESP32-WROOM-32E (4MB) module, backup capacitor and an SN74AHCT level converter to ensure trouble-free operation of the LEDs.

Attention: the voltage of your power supply must always correspond to the voltage of the LEDs!  For example, for 12V LEDs you need a 12V power supply.

Usage information: WLED_V43_Controller_Usage_Info.pdf

Attention LED strips with Clock signal: depending on LED type you would eventully need to reduce the Clock from "Normal" to "Slow" in LED preferences for stable operation of the strip.

Attention analogue, non-addressable (PWM controlled) LED strips: additional hardware is required as described in WLED FAQ, section "LED strips", question "How do you control analogue LED strips?".

Technical data:

  • Supply voltage: 4.7 V to 24.3 V
  • Ambient temperature operation: +5°C … +35 °C
  • WiFi standard: IEEE 802.11 b/g/n, 2.4 GHz
  • Dimensions: 78x46.5x22 mm
  • Maximum permanent current carrying capacity power path (+V, GND): up to 13 A (depending on cable cross section and environment)
  • Average power consumption in power on state (without load path): 0.60 W
  • Average power consumption in power off (networked standby mode): 0.27 W
  • Average power consumption in AP mode (configuration mode): 0.6 W
  • Current consumption, peak (without load): 800 mA
  • Efficiency at full load: typically 94%
  • Power loss at full load: typ. 4 W
  • Ambient temperature storage/transport: -20 °C … 60 °C
  • Screw terminals: Target torque: 0.4 Nm
  • Screw terminals, cable cross section: 0.5 … 2.5 mm2, rigid or flexible with wire end sleeve Screw terminals, stripping/sleeve length: 6-7 mm / 8 mm
  • Antenna: integrated circuit board antenna 3.7 dBi
  • Weight: 29.2 g
  • Maximum permanent current carrying capacity of the power path of the device (power supply connection to the LED strip connection, each for +V and GND)*: Cable cross section / maximum permanent current carrying capacity (*):
  • 0.5 mm2 / 3 A
  • 0.75 mm2 / 6 A
  • 1 mm2 / 9 A
  • 1.5 mm2 - 2.5 mm2 / 13 A

*This information alone may not be used to dimension the cables. To do this, other conditions such as line type, type of installation, line routing, line length, etc. must be taken into account.
